Lyman, a community in Uinta County, Wyoming, has 1,777 residents. Its median household income of $101,080 runs above the Uinta County figure of $82,672.
From 2019 to 2023, Lyman's population declined 22.2% from 2,285 to 1,777, while its median home value rose 39.9% from $191,200 to $267,500.
The median resident is 35.7 years old. The largest age group is 5 to 17, 28.3% of residents.
